GCSE Chemistry: Atmosphere & Resources โ Quick Burst Practice is a short, timed five-round recall workbook covering AQA GCSE Chemistry Topics 9 and 10 (specification 5.9–5.10), mapped to the DfE National Curriculum for science. In about ten minutes, learners fire off the evolution of the atmosphere (volcanic gases, oceans forming and carbon locked into fossil fuels), today’s air and the greenhouse effect, the pollutants from burning fuels (carbon monoxide, particulates and oxides of nitrogen), making water safe to drink, and using resources through recycling, bioleaching and phytomining. All 15 questions are auto-marked on screen with instant feedback and a full answer key. This is the quick-burst set of an Atmosphere & Using Resources pack, ideal as a starter or warm-up.
